Understanding Your Breakeven Point

By |2023-07-17T15:02:53+10:00July 17th, 2023|Accountant Life, Business, Companies|

Understanding your business breakeven point is essential to know how much money you need to make to stay in business. It can therefore help you make well-informed financial decisions and practical business plans. The breakeven point is the income or sales needed to cover all costs.
